Fly Dragon Drone Tech is a leading developer of advanced hybrid VTOL UAV frames and multirotor drone platforms, as well as ground control stations (GCS), gimbals and propulsion systems. Our products, which have been selected by enterprise clients and government agencies worldwide, are suitable for a wide range of applications, including precision agriculture, inspection and mapping, surveillance, logistics and cargo delivery, and more.

Hybrid VTOL & Multirotor UAVs

FDG50F Hybrid VTOL UAV

Long-endurance UAV frame with 10kg payload capacity

Hybrid Long endurance UAV VTOLThe FD50F is a hybrid VTOL/fixed-wing UAV frame designed for long-endurance operations, with a maximum flight time of over 10 hours and a payload capacity of 15kg. The versatile platform features a waterproof design and can be quickly assembled in just 3 minutes.

FDG51 Hybrid VTOL Tandem-Wing UAV

Heavy-payload drone with 55kg capacity

Tandem Wing UAV - Heavy payload droneThe FDG51 is a heavy-lift VTOL drone with a unique tandem-wing configuration and a lightweight carbon fiber construction. Able to carry up to 55 kg, the modular platform can be assembled in under 10 minutes.

H620L Multirotor Drone for Agriculture Use

Crop-spraying drone with hybrid power systemMultirotor crop sprayer drone for agriculture use

The H620L is a UAV sprayer drone designed for agricultural use, featuring a 20-litre tank capacity. The platform features a hybrid gas-electric power system, and can cover up to 3 acres per minute.

Ground Control Stations & Accessories

FD2800 Drone Ground Station

Industrial-grade portable GCS with HD displayHandheld Ground Station for Drone

The FD2800 is a portable handheld Windows or Linux-based ground station for UAVs and unmanned systems, featuring a 10.1-inch HD touchscreen display. With mappable buttons and joysticks and a rugged IP54-rated enclosure made from aircraft-grade aluminium, it can be adapted to a wide range of requirements.

Rugged UAV Ground Control Station

Dual-screen drone control station in military-grade caseRugged Drone Control Station

Our rugged UAV GCS is a dual-screen station enclosed within an IP-67-rated military-grade carrying case. Based on Windows 10, it features an industrial-grade keyboard and mouse, plus a variety of buttons, switches and joysticks.

FD10CX Drone Camera Gimbal

30x stabilized drone camera with laser rangefinderStabilized Drone Camera Gimbal

The FD10CX is a stabilized gimbal EO/IR payload for UAVs, featuring a 1920×1090 visible camera, a 640×512 LWIR thermal imager, and a laser rangefinder. It is ideal for detection, identification and tracking of a range of different targets, including humans, animals, vehicles and vessels.

Gas powered UAV Hybrid GeneratorFD-2000W UAV Hybrid Generator

Gas-powered generator for multirotor drones

The FD-2000W is a lightweight and compact gasoline-powered generator for multirotor UAVs. Providing 1.8 kW of continuous power, the high-efficiency generator can be electrically started via PWM or CANbus.

EFI hybrid drone generatorFD-6000W Hybrid Drone Generator

EFI hybrid generator with 6 kW output

The FD-6000W is a powerful drone generator based around a twin-cylinder two-stroke EFI engine. Featuring an automotive-grade 32-bit MCU and precise fuel injection ignition, it delivers up to 6 kW of power for demanding UAV applications.

High thrust Drone Motor KitG90 Drone Motor Kit

High-thrust drone motor set for heavy-lift UAVs

The G90 is a high-thrust motor set designed for heavy-lift drones. The set includes a motor, carbon fiber and epoxy propeller, and 160-amp electronic speed controller, and provides a maximum thrust of 165 kg.
